How Binance Trading Works for Retail Traders

Binance, one of the largest cryptocurrency exchanges globally, has revolutionized the way retail traders engage with digital assets. For individuals looking to enter the world of crypto trading, Binance offers a comprehensive platform that combines user-friendly features with advanced tools, making it accessible for beginners while still catering to experienced traders.

At its core, Binance operates as a centralized exchange where users can buy and sell a wide variety of cryptocurrencies. Retail traders start by creating an account on the platform, which involves completing identity verification processes to comply with regulatory standards. Once registered, users can deposit funds through various methods such as bank transfers, credit cards, or by transferring cryptocurrencies from other wallets.

The trading interface on Binance is designed to be intuitive yet powerful. Retail traders can choose between basic and advanced views depending on their level of expertise. The basic view simplifies the process by displaying essential information like price charts and order book data in an easy-to-understand format. In contrast, the advanced view offers detailed technical indicators and charting tools for those who want to perform in-depth market analysis.

When placing trades, retail traders have several options including market orders, limit orders, stop-limit orders, and more. Market orders execute immediately blockmanual at current prices while limit orders allow users to set specific price points at which they want transactions to occur. This flexibility helps traders manage risk and optimize their entry or exit points based on personal strategies.

Binance also supports spot trading alongside margin trading and futures contracts for those interested in leveraging their positions or speculating on price movements without owning underlying assets directly. However, margin trading involves borrowing funds which increases both potential profits and risks; therefore it is recommended only for experienced retail investors who understand these dynamics thoroughly.
